Subject: Harrowgate Region Expansion — Briefing for Incoming Director

Welcome aboard, Maren. Ahead of your start date, please review the Harrowgate expansion file. Site selection in Velden Cross is complete, staffing plans are drafted, and regulatory filings are in progress. Timelines remain provisional pending lease approval. To give you full context on why this region was prioritized, I am including the confidential note below.

board note of bajef-kagug: Soririx Systems plans to raise the Oliwyn list price by 14.9 percent in July. The pricing group signed off on a budget of $404.4 million for Project Kelath. The renewal with Quenionax Freight closes at $241.2 million a year, 65.7 percent above the last contract. Project Sormir slips by a full year because of the audit delay.

- [ ] **Step 7: Breaker override escrow.** After sealing the signing keys for the Tallgrove upstream API circuit breaker, confirm the support team can force the breaker open during a full outage. The override bundle lives in the sealed escrow drawer and is useless without its unlock phrase. Two ceremony witnesses must initial this step before proceeding. The escrow bundle is decrypted with the recovery passphrase that follows.

vault phrase of kahip-kahop = holath-quenmir

Hi, welcome to the rotation! Quick heads-up for you and whoever inherits this next: the Pinefold image cache leaks memory slowly — thumbnails get pinned when the eviction thread loses a race with the resize worker. We restart the cache pods every Sunday as a stopgap. If heap climbs past 70% midweek, do a rolling restart early; it's safe. Rourke's write-up with graphs and the proper fix proposal is here.

operations page: https://jenkins.zemvarcloud.local/job/merge_requests/repo/build/73930b4b30f0a8ed

Onboarding note for the Ledgerpane admin table: bulk edits are applied through the batcher service, not directly against the database. Select rows, choose an action, and the batcher stages changes in a pending set you can review before commit. Edits over 500 rows require a second approver — this is enforced server-side, so don't try to chunk around it. To run the batcher locally you need the staging write credential, which goes in your .env as the next line.

secret setting of bahip-kagag: RELAY_SECRET3=c83